
首先我觉得这个架构好处是实现原理简单,而且扩展性d性比起RISC架构来好处不言而喻但其实这个架构里面也存在着无谓的资源浪费可能性例如拿存储而言,目前Hadoop类的多副本分布式存储很火一份数据存三份,发现有数据损坏立即找空闲空间恢复听上去很简单很容易实现很高效,但如果你真的坐下来仔细算算账,你就会发现:
1 当你数据量不大(小于PB)的情况下这种一份数据存三份方式的成本其实比现有任何商业存储方案的成本都要高
2 这种方式下每台服务器的CPU利用率都很低,而现在市面上的大存储容量服务器,CPU配置都很高所以这种方式,基本上是对于CPU资源的一种浪费所以,或许对于数据量适中的企业来说,用EC CODE这种以计算能力换存储的分布式存储解决方案会比多副本方案更经济实惠
3 这种方式很容易让IT运维人员产生一种惯性思维 即要提高系统在线时间就多买些服务器就好了因为服务器多了分布性好了自然冗余度就高了于是不必要的服务器采购就这么产生了,每个数据中心也就又多了很大一笔不是很必要的电费开销
其次,我觉得分布式架构的某些故障很可能会产生连锁效应,导致更严重全局瘫痪打个比方,大家都知道赤壁之战的故事里面有个很著名的桥段就是庞统献连环计,铁锁连舟起始时使曹 *** 万余战船连成一体稳如平地进可攻退可守前后都可照应看似完美,但唯有一个命门就是怕火攻而诸葛亮周瑜正是利用这个命门,解东风火烧赤壁把曹 *** 百万大军杀的丢盔卸甲互联网的分布式架构其实我觉得也有类似命门大型机之所以那么贵,其实很多时候用户在为千万分之一甚至亿万分之一的万一买单而互联网,现在的公有云架构,在设计之初,基本的考虑思路是大用户,大并发,然后尽量减少TCO所以很多时候,设计架构时会先把那些千万分之一排除在外,暂时不予考虑而系统上线之后,稳定运行一段时间用户量,精力往往又会去专注扩容方面了搞不好就会把一些命门漏掉,于是乎万一正好遇上东风吹到了命门上,后果估计会比曹阿瞒更惨因为IT世界里还没有那么仁义的关云长会在华容道上放曹 *** 一马
最后,我想说互联网,云计算的业务类型其实和传统企业的业务类型不一样,所以大型机,系统处理的任务,运行的计算并不一定都适合移植到分布式系统架构上来还是以交通运输举例:我要去美国,目前还是只有飞机可以满足我的需求当然你可以说我坐动车也可以,无非是多转几趟跨国列车但那毕竟很勉强,速度不快,费时费力还不省钱,毫无意义人家直接飞过去就行了,你却要绕着太平洋海岸线跑一个大圈来兜,何必呢
那么以上这些问题有没有办法解决呢其实我觉得解决以上问题的关键就是两个字:运维分布式系统,要保障其安全可靠的运行,合理有效的扩容,关键不在系统的软硬件,而是在系统搭建之后的运维和持续的对系统的改进修正!现在网络上很多人都在热衷于各种开源架构如openstack,Hadoop的开发,应用场景探讨但个人以为这些开源系统的特点是搭建简单,维护艰难!要想把这些架构和技术真正投入企业成熟应用,在运维管理上投入的成本可能大得多因为这些系统架构更分散,出现的不可预估性更多,同时也更需要有人来理清何时用分布式架构,何种场景还是需要传统架构那么可能有人要问,既然如此,我们还有必要走分布式系统这条路吗当然有!原因也很简单:分布式架构给了我们处理海量请求的能力和应对突发事件的d性;同时分布式架构也使系统具备了更好的扩展能力和更多业务创新的可能性。
信息技术(Information
Technology,简称IT),是主要用于管理和处理信息所采用的各种技术的总称。它主要是应用计算机科学和通信技术来设计、开发、安装和实施信息系统及应用软件。它也常被称为信息和通信技术(Information
and
Communications
Technology,
ICT)。主要包括传感技术、计算机技术和通信技术。
网络技术是从1990年代中期发展起来的新技术,它把互联网上分散的资源融为有机整体,实现资源的全面共享和有机协作,使人们能够透明地使用资源的整体能力并按需获取信息。资源包括高性能计算机、存储资源、数据资源、信息资源、知识资源、专家资源、大型数据库、网络、传感器等。
当前的互联网只限于信息共享,网络则被认为是互联网发展的第三阶段。网络可以构造地区性的网络、企事业内部网络、局域网网络,甚至家庭网络和个人网络。网络的根本特征并不一定是它的规模,而是资源共享,消除资源孤岛。
网络技术具有很大的应用潜力,能同时调动数百万台计算机完成某一个计算任务,能汇集数千科学家之力共同完成同一项科学试验,还可以让分布在各地的人们在虚拟环境中实现面对面交流。
近两年互联网产品经理职位暴火,很多传统软件行业的需求工程师、设计师都改称为“产品经理”,(在招聘网站中搜索一下就有体会喽,有木有)。在此,旨在说明传统软件行业的产品经理和互联网产品经理有什么区别?
1传统软件产品和互联网产品有什么区别
我们首先需要清楚传统软件产品和互联网产品有什么区别,总结如下:
注:传统软件并非不可跨入互联网, 随着云技术的发展,硬件设备的廉价,越来越多的企业将数据中心移到了云端。随着移动终端的普及,终端用户可能成为产品的主导,传统自顶向下的销售模式也可能被打破。但必须先把项目升级为产品,项目和产品有什么区别?项目是为某一个客户定制开发的,而产品需要具有通用性。那么项目如何才能转变为产品?只有对业务的理解达到一定深度,才有可能设计出通用的产品。所以合理的方式一般是选定一个业务范围,并且在该业务范围经过长期同类项目的业务积累,然后才可能对积累的业务进行分析,而后设计产品。
如何才能做到业务通用?我们常抱怨一个行业的不同单位业务需求都相差很多,每个项目都重新开发,似乎很难做到通用,但是请看一下ERP软件,其同一个ERP产品在许多行业(包括跨行业)都有成功实施的案例,其项目实施过程与我们平时做的项目截然不同,开发工作量非常小,绝大部分需求都是通过配置来完成的,几个人就可以实施上千万的项目。他们为什么能做到,不只是因为采用了多么先进的技术架构,而是因为把业务做到了极致,它已经建立起了那些可以搭建业务平台的积木。再复杂的需求,都可以用这些积木搭建出来。
所以,从业务复杂度来说,传统软件更复杂。
IT是一种信息技术,ITC是联合国贸易与发展大会和世贸组织联合设置的机构。
IT是指:互联网技术是指在计算机技术的基础上开发建立的一种信息技术;
计算机网络是指将地理位置不同的具有独立功能的多台计算机及其外部设备,通过通信线路连接起来,在网络 *** 作系统,网络管理软件及网络通信协议的管理和协调下,实现资源共享和信息传递的计算机系统。
ITC是联合国贸易与发展大会(UNCTAD)和世贸组织(WTO)联合设置的机构;
于1964年成立,由联合国和世贸组织共同管理,并作为联合国开发计划署的执行机构,直接负责执行开发计划署资助的发展中国家和转型经济国家贸易促进项目。
扩展资料:
主要领域:
IT:计算机网络也称计算机通信网。关于计算机网络的最简单定义是:一些相互连接的、以共享资源为目的的、自治的计算机的集合。
若按此定义,则早期的面向终端的网络都不能算是计算机网络,而只能称为联机系统(因为那时的许多终端不能算是自治的计算机)。
但随着硬件价格的下降,许多终端都具有一定的智能,因而“终端”和“自治的计算机”逐渐失去了严格的界限。
若用微型计算机作为终端使用,按上述定义,则早期的那种面向终端的网络也可称为计算机网络。
ITC:
1、 开发产品和开拓市场;
2、 开展支持贸易业务;
3、 贸易信息;
4、 开发人力资源;
5、 国际采购和供应管理;
6、 贸易促进的需求评估与方案策划。
扩展资料来源:百度百科-IT
扩展资料来源:百度百科-ITC
以上就是关于浅析互联网系统和传统企业IT系统的异同全部的内容,包括:浅析互联网系统和传统企业IT系统的异同、请问一下,信息技术和网络技术有什么区别呢、传统软件产品与互联网产品的区别等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)